Marcus, what happens from there? Once that thing started, it was kind of a free for all.

1:30.3

They had us covered on three sides, so the only way we could go was down the mountain.

1:35.4

And then a couple hours into that, they had come up from the base of the mountain from the village.

1:39.3

So they had us in a 360-degree loot.

1:41.5

There wasn't really anywhere we could go, which means you had to keep moving the entire time.

1:45.6

The hardest thing to hit is a moving target.

1:48.7

But because of the terrain and the altitude,

1:51.0

just making the movement was tough enough.

1:53.0

By a couple hours into it,

1:54.5

everyone was so exhausted and shot up

1:57.0

that they just systematically pick us apart one by one

1:59.3

as we were going down the mountain.
